Team India scripted history by winning their very first bilateral ODI series in Australia yesterday. The impressive innings by team India has left the internet overwhelmed. With a target of 231 runs to chase, India defeated Australia with four balls and 7 wickets to spare. While Yuzvendra Chahal ruled the first half sending six batsmen back to the pavilion, MS Dhoni stormed the Melbourne Cricket Ground by hitting 87 runs off 114 balls.
Dhoni’s pivotal role in making team India write another history is certainly inevitable!
It was the third consecutive match in the series where Dhoni crossed the score of fifty making the chase smoother for his team.
Dhoni’s thunderous performance in the series bagged him the coveted title of ‘Man of the series’ which has left netizens delighted.
